Report: A's to sign SP Kazmir to two-year, $22-million deal

by

Scott Kazmir's reportedly hit the free-agent starting pitcher jackpot, signing a two-year deal with Oakland worth a reported $22 million, tweets ESPN's Buster Olney. 

The deal has a couple of ramifications for the A's: 

Bartolo Colon feels he can do even better -- more money and more years --than the two years, and $11-million annually Kazmir received, tweets Yahoo Sports' Jeff Passan. 

Colon believes in himself, if nothing else.
